Why You May Need to Remove Your Granite Waterfall Pump
Several reasons may compel you to consider the removal of your natural granite waterfall pump:
Upgrading to a More Efficient Model: As technology advances, newer, more efficient pumps can enhance the aesthetics and functionality of your waterfall feature.
Maintenance Issues: Over time, pumps can wear out or become clogged, requiring professional intervention for either repair or removal.
Changing Landscape Design: If you’re redesigning your garden or outdoor space, a waterfall pump may no longer fit your vision.
Safety Concerns: An old or malfunctioning pump can pose safety risks, especially if it leads to water pooling or electrical hazards.
The Importance of Professional Removal
Attempting to remove a granite waterfall pump on your own can lead to various complications, including potential damage to your landscaping and even injury. Here are some reasons why hiring a professional contractor is crucial:
Expertise and Experience: Professional contractors have the knowledge and experience to handle all aspects of pump removal safely and efficiently.
Proper Equipment: Specialized tools and equipment are often required for the safe removal of heavy granite stones and complex pump systems.
Disposal Compliance: Contractors ensure that all materials are disposed of according to local regulations, reducing environmental impact and legal liabilities.
Preventing Damage: Professionals understand how to navigate your landscape without causing damage to surrounding plants, structures, or other features.
